Story 1:
A mechanic named Dave attempted to remove a rear axle bearing without properly supporting the axle shaft. The result? A bent axle shaft that cost him an extra $200 to replace!
Lesson: Always support the axle shaft when removing rear axle bearings.
Story 2:
During a routine inspection, a technician named Sarah noticed a loose rear axle bearing on a customer's vehicle. However, the customer declined to have it replaced immediately, claiming it was "just a little noise." A few days later, the bearing seized up on the highway, leaving the customer stranded and needing a tow.
Lesson: Don't ignore symptoms of a worn rear axle bearing. Replace it promptly to prevent costly breakdowns.
Story 3:
One day, a DIY enthusiast named John decided to replace his rear axle bearings himself. However, he used a too-small puller that slipped off the bearing and sent it flying across the garage. The bearing hit the wall and bounced back, narrowly missing John's head!
Lesson: Use the correct size and type of puller for the job. Safety first!
